Your Guide to the Best Tool for Cutting Tree Limbs
Cutting tree limbs can be a big job. You need the right tool to make it safe and easy. This guide will help you pick the perfect tool for your needs. Let’s get started!
Key Features to Look For
When you’re shopping, keep these important things in mind:
- Blade Length: Longer blades can reach higher branches. Shorter blades offer more control for smaller jobs.
- Handle Length: Long handles give you extra reach. They also let you use your body weight for more power.
- Blade Type: Some blades are straight, while others are curved. Curved blades often cut cleaner.
- Grip Comfort: A good grip stops your hands from getting tired. Look for padded or ergonomic handles.
- Weight: A lighter tool is easier to use for a long time.
- Safety Features: Some tools have safety locks to keep them from opening by accident.
Important Materials
The materials used make a big difference in how well a tool works and how long it lasts.
- Blades: High-quality blades are usually made from strong steel. This steel can be sharpened and stays sharp longer. Some blades have special coatings to stop rust.
- Handles: Handles can be made of metal, fiberglass, or strong plastic. Fiberglass handles are often light and strong. Metal handles can be durable but might be heavier.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
Not all tools are made the same. Here’s what makes a tool great or not so great:
- Sharpness of the Blade: A sharp blade cuts through branches easily. A dull blade makes the job harder and can damage the tree.
- Durability of Materials: Strong materials mean the tool won’t break easily. Cheap plastic or weak metal can lead to problems.
- Ease of Use: A well-designed tool feels good in your hands. It should be easy to open, close, and maneuver.
- Maintenance: Some tools are easy to clean and sharpen. Others need special care.
- Brand Reputation: Well-known brands often make better quality tools. They stand behind their products.
User Experience and Use Cases
Think about how you’ll use the tool. This will help you choose the right one.
- For Small Branches: Hand pruners or loppers are great for branches up to about 1-2 inches thick. They are easy to handle and control.
- For Medium Branches: Loppers with longer handles work well for branches up to 3 inches thick.
- For High Branches: Pole saws or pole pruners are designed to reach branches high up in trees. They have long poles that extend.
- For Big Jobs: If you have many trees or thick branches, you might need a chainsaw. However, chainsaws require more skill and safety precautions.
- For Clean Cuts: A sharp bypass pruner makes a clean cut that is good for the tree’s health.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: What is the best tool for cutting small branches?
A: Hand pruners are best for small branches, usually up to 3/4 inch thick. They offer great control.
Q: How do I choose a lopper for thicker branches?
A: Look for loppers with longer handles and strong, sharp blades. Bypass loppers are good for clean cuts.
Q: What is a pole saw used for?
A: A pole saw is used to cut branches that are too high to reach from the ground.
Q: Are electric or gas chainsaws better for trimming limbs?
A: For trimming limbs, electric chainsaws are often lighter and easier to handle. Gas chainsaws are more powerful for bigger jobs.
Q: How often should I sharpen my pruning tools?
A: You should sharpen your tools regularly, especially if you use them a lot. A dull blade makes cutting harder.
Q: What safety gear do I need when cutting tree limbs?
A: Always wear safety glasses, sturdy gloves, and wear long sleeves and pants. If using a pole saw or chainsaw, a hard hat is also recommended.
Q: Can I use any knife to cut a small branch?
A: No, it’s not recommended. A knife is not designed for cutting branches and can be dangerous. Use proper pruning tools.
Q: What does “bypass pruner” mean?
A: A bypass pruner works like scissors. One blade slides past the other, making a clean cut that is good for the plant.
Q: How do I clean my pruning tools?
A: After each use, wipe the blades clean. You can use a soft cloth. For tougher sap, use a mild soap and water solution.
Q: Are expensive tree limb cutters worth the money?
A: Often, yes. Higher quality tools use better materials and are designed for durability and ease of use, making them a better investment in the long run.
